One of the standout features of Tualatin’s real estate market is its enchanting collection of Dutch Colonial-style homes. Characterized by their distinctive symmetrical facades, gabled roofs, and charming dormer windows, these homes exude timeless elegance and character. The Dutch Colonial style, which emerged in the early 20th century, is celebrated for its spacious interiors and inviting outdoor spaces, making them perfect for families and entertaining guests alike.
